Litterateur Manoj Das to get Padma Bhushan, nine others from Odisha to receive Padma Shri

Bhubaneswar, Jan 25: Eminent litterateur from Odisha, Manoj Das has been conferred Padma Bhushan, the country’s third-highest civilian award. Besides, eight others from Odisha, including a father-daughter duo, will receive the prestigious Padma Shri award on the 71st Republic Day celebrations. The government on Saturday announced the names of this year’s recipients of the Padma awards. The list had 141 awards – seven Padma Vibhushan, 16 Padma Bhushan and 118 Padma Shri. Thirty-four of the recipients were women. Here is the list of Padma Shri awardees from Odisha Dr Damayanti Beshra – Literature and Education; Utsav Charan Das – Art; Mitrabhanu Gountia – Art; Manmohan Mahapatra – (posthumous) Art; Binapani Mohanty – Literature and Education; Radha Mohan and Sabarmatee – Agriculture; Batakrushna Sahoo – Animal Husbandry; Dr Digambar Behera – Medicine; Dr. Prasanta Kumar Pattanaik – Literature and Education
